Energy band gap of Zinc(Hydr)oxide using absorption, fluorescence and photoconductivity

Not Accessible

Your library or personal account may give you access

Abstract

The band gaps of zinc (hydr)oxide materials were determined in a spectral range 300nm to 800nm at a room temperature. Using absorption, fluorescence and photoconductivity, the band gap of Zn(OH)2 calculated between 3.00eV and 3.06eV and urbach energy is 0.36eV .
